Quote:

elprawn said:
So you think perhaps I could colonise a bed with both species and I'd get a few flushes of each in their respective seasons? Or would the mycelium of one outcompete the other and leave me with only an annual fruiting?





I think it would be a cool experiment.  I know different species that occupy the same habitat.  Since the mycelial grow rate of wood lovers like Cyans and Ovoids are similar if the chips inoculated by the spawn were mixed thoroughly there shouldn't be any reason to have a fall fruiting of Cyans and a spring fruiting of Ovoids.  Alternatively, no matter how much space you have you can divide the bed into two parts.  I've seen beds that were only 30 cm x 30 cm.
